3. Test Results and Clinical Interpretation
3.1 Dandruff and Scalp Flaking Reduction
Result: Up to 100% reduction in visible dandruff flakes.
A consumer clinical study evaluated 34 subjects with moderate dandruff scores above 15. Following the use of the BBLUNT Anti-Dandruff Combo, subjects experienced up to a 100% reduction in visible flakes and adherent scalp build-up compared to their baseline measurements.
3.2 Hair Smoothness (Friction Test)
Result: 57.11% improvement in surface slip (1.57 times smoother).
The friction test measures the mechanical force required to pull a probe across the hair swatch at 100mm/min. The test regime reduced the friction force from 7.18 gf (control) to 4.57 gf. This significant reduction in mechanical friction indicates enhanced cuticle alignment and improved combability.
3.3 Hair Strength (Tensile Test)
Result: 23.85% increase in tensile strength (1.24 times stronger).
Tensile testing measures the pull force required to break individual hair fibers from root to tip. The test regime increased the mean break force from 55.77 gf (control) to 69.07 gf. This demonstrates that the conditioning agents reinforce the hair cortex, improving structural integrity and resistance to mechanical snapping.
3.4 Hair Shine (Luster Assessment)
Result: 34.66% increase in specular light reflection (1.35 times shinier).
Luster assessment measures the spectral profile of light reflected off the hair swatch under a 1500 lux light box. The test regime increased the mean luster value from 8.87 (control) to 11.94. This confirms that the formulation smooths the hair surface topography to maximize gloss and radiance without leaving a heavy residue.
4. Formulation Architecture
The BBLUNT Anti-Dandruff Combo utilizes a multi-targeted approach to eliminate scalp fungus, soothe irritation, and restore hair fiber integrity.
4.1 Dual Anti-Dandruff & Antimicrobial System
| Active System | Key Components | Mechanism of Action |
|---|---|---|
| Antifungal Actives | Zinc Pyrithione, Piroctone Olamine | Zinc Pyrithione disrupts fungal cell membranes to inhibit Malassezia growth. Piroctone Olamine chelates trace metals to prevent fungal replication and reduce scalp desquamation. |
| Botanical Soothers | Tea Tree Oil, Ziziphus Joazeiro Bark Extract | Tea Tree Oil provides natural ant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ties. Ziziphus Joazeiro Bark Extract cleanses the scalp and reduces itching and flaking. |
4.2 Cuticle Sealing & Structural Reinforcement
| Active System | Key Components | Mechanism of Action |
|---|---|---|
| Friction Reduction Matrix | Amodimethicone, Behentrimonium Chloride, Shea Butter | Cationic surfactants selectively bind to negatively charged damaged areas on the hair cuticle. This neutralizes static electricity and drives the 57.11% reduction in mechanical friction. |
| Shine Tonic Complex | Bis-Diisopropanolamino-PG-Propyl Disiloxane/Bis-Vinyl Dimethicone Copolymer | Forms a lightweight, high-refractive-index film over the hair shaft. This optimizes specular light reflection to deliver the 34.66% increase in luster. |
5. Published Research Supporting Key Ingredients
| Ingredient | Primary Published Finding | Study Reference |
|---|---|---|
| Zinc Pyrithione | Broad-spectrum antifungal agent that effectively reduces Malassezia colonization and resolves seborrheic dermatitis | Gupta et al., 2003, PMID: 12887352 |
| Piroctone Olamine | Chelates trace metals to inhibit fungal metabolism; demonstrates superior cosmetic elegance and reduced scalp irritation compared to older antifungals | Skinner et al., 1996, PMID: 8882818 |
| Tea Tree Oil | Contains terpinen-4-ol which exhibits significant ant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ory activity against dandruff-causing pathogens | Satchell et al., 2002, PMID: 12492813 |
| Amodimethicone | Selectively deposits on damaged hair sites to reduce combing force, minimize friction, and protect against mechanical breakage | Robbins, 2012, PMID: 22694376 |
